Bio

Andrew Schoene, Director, is based out of the company’s Milwaukee, Wisconsin office, and focuses on arranging financing for multifamily, office, industrial, retail, and hospitality properties throughout the United States.

 

He has extensive relationships in the capital markets and has closed transactions with more than 25 different life insurance companies, Freddie Mac, Fannie Mae, CMBS providers, debt funds, as well as numerous local, regional, and national banks. Since joining Walker & Dunlop, Mr. Schoene has been directly involved in arranging more than $1 billion in debt with structures including permanent financing, construction, bridge, and mezzanine financing.

 

Prior to joining Walker & Dunlop, Mr. Schoene served as Vice President at BMO Harris Bank where he originated and managed commercial real estate loans for Milwaukee-based real estate development and investment groups.

 

Mr. Schoene attended Marquette University where he earned a bachelor’s degree in finance with an emphasis on real estate.

 

Beyond the company, Mr. Schoene is a member of the National Association for Industrial and Office Parks (NAIOP), Commercial Association of Realtors Wisconsin (CARW), and he is a board member of Real Estate Alumni of Marquette (REALM).
